Blotting Tank Market Trends 2026–2034: Strong Growth at 8.67% CAGR
The global Blotting Tank Market is witnessing significant growth due to the increasing adoption of molecular biology techniques across research laboratories, biotechnology companies, pharmaceutical organizations, and academic institutions. Blotting tanks are essential laboratory equipment used in protein and nucleic acid transfer procedures, particularly in Western, Southern, and Northern blotting applications..
Market Overview
According to market analysis, the global blotting
tank market size is projected to reach US$ 1,182 million by 2034,
growing from US$ 559.39 million in 2025. The market is expected to
register a CAGR of 8.67% during the forecast period from 2026 to 2034.
This robust growth reflects increasing investments in life sciences research,
expanding biotechnology sectors, and rising demand for advanced laboratory
equipment. The Blotting Tank Market is also benefiting from technological
innovations that improve transfer efficiency, reproducibility, and user
convenience.

Technological Advancements Enhancing Product Efficiency
Continuous technological innovations are transforming the
blotting tank landscape. Manufacturers are introducing compact,
energy-efficient, and user-friendly systems equipped with enhanced cooling
mechanisms and optimized transfer technologies. Modern blotting tanks offer
improved transfer speed, better protein retention, and reduced experiment time.
Automation features and digital monitoring capabilities are further enhancing
laboratory productivity. These innovations are expected to create new growth opportunities
for market participants throughout the forecast period.

Regional Analysis and Emerging Opportunities
North America currently dominates the market owing to its
strong biotechnology industry, extensive research infrastructure, and high
healthcare expenditure. The United States remains a major contributor due to
substantial investments in biomedical research and pharmaceutical innovation.
Europe follows closely with increasing funding for scientific research and
growing biotechnology activities.
Meanwhile, the Asia-Pacific region is expected to register
the fastest growth during the forecast period. Countries such as China, India,
Japan, and South Korea are witnessing rapid expansion in biotechnology
research, pharmaceutical manufacturing, and academic collaborations. Government
initiatives promoting scientific innovation and healthcare advancements are
creating lucrative opportunities for market players in the region.
